Crime overview

Rusham Road area has the 7th lowest crime rate of 103 local areas in Balham , and the 41st lowest crime rate of 805 local areas in Wandsworth .

This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Rusham Road (SW12 8TH) in the last 12 months was 15.0 per 1,000 residents and was 88.7% lower than the Balham average (133.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Vehicle crime with 3 offences recorded. The least common crime was Violent crimes with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Vehicle crime ( 50.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.

Violent crimes totalled 1 (≈ 3.8 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 0.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-94.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Rusham Road (SW12 8TH), the main crime hotspot is near Linnet Mews. Police recorded 28 crimes here, including 8 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
